Warm hiking boots are specifically designed to provide insulation and keep your feet warm in cold weather conditions. They are often made with materials such as Thinsulate or Gore-Tex, which are known for their excellent insulation properties. These boots also have a thick lining and insulation layers that trap heat and prevent it from escaping, ensuring that your feet stay warm and cozy. Additionally, some warm hiking boots come with features like waterproofing and breathability, which further enhance their performance in cold and wet conditions.

The Hidden Secret of Warm Hiking Boots

The hidden secret of warm hiking boots lies in their construction and insulation materials. These boots are often made with multiple layers of insulation, such as Thinsulate or PrimaLoft, which provide excellent warmth without adding bulk. Additionally, they may have a waterproof membrane or coating that keeps your feet dry in wet conditions. The soles of warm hiking boots are also designed to provide traction and stability on slippery surfaces, ensuring that you can hike with confidence even in icy conditions.

How to Break in Warm Hiking Boots

Breaking in your warm hiking boots is an essential step to ensure maximum comfort during your hikes. To break them in, start by wearing them around the house for short periods of time. Gradually increase the duration and distance of wearing them until they feel comfortable. You can also wear them on shorter hikes before taking them on longer treks. Additionally, make sure to wear proper socks that provide moisture-wicking and cushioning for added comfort.

How to Clean and Maintain Warm Hiking Boots

Properly cleaning and maintaining your warm hiking boots is essential for their longevity and performance. Here are a few tips to help you keep your boots in top condition:

1. Remove any dirt or debris from your boots using a soft brush or cloth.

2. If your boots are muddy, rinse them with water to remove the excess dirt. Avoid using soap unless necessary.

3. Allow your boots to air dry naturally, away from direct heat sources.

4. Once dry, apply a waterproofing treatment to restore the water repellency of the boots.

5. Store your boots in a cool, dry place, away from direct sunlight.

What If You Don't Have Warm Hiking Boots?

If you don't have warm hiking boots, there are a few alternatives you can try to keep your feet warm during your hikes. One option is to wear multiple layers of socks, preferably made of moisture-wicking and insulating materials. You can also use foot warmers or heated insoles to provide additional warmth. However, it's important to note that these alternatives may not provide the same level of insulation and protection as warm hiking boots, so it's still recommended to invest in a pair if you plan on hiking in cold weather frequently.

Listicle: 5 Must-Have Warm Hiking Boots

1. The North Face Chilkat III: These boots are known for their superior warmth and protection, with a waterproof leather upper and 200g of PrimaLoft insulation.

2. Columbia Bugaboot Plus IV Omni-Heat: These boots offer ultimate warmth and comfort, featuring a waterproof leather and textile upper, 200g of insulation, and Omni-Heat reflective lining.

3. Salomon Quest 4D 3 GTX: These boots are not only warm but also provide excellent support and traction, with a Gore-Tex membrane and insulation for warmth.

4. Merrell Moab Polar Waterproof: These boots are perfect for winter hikes, with a waterproof suede and leather upper, M Select WARM insulation, and an air cushion in the heel for added comfort.

5. KEEN Targhee III Mid WP: These boots are both warm and versatile, with a waterproof leather and textile upper, KEEN.WARM insulation, and a high-traction outsole for stability.
